R58 Driver side door not closing?
Driver side door not closing?
I'm just about at 1000 miles on my Coupe and I love everything about it. One thing I did notice was that the driver's side door latch is either out of alignment of the lock movement is too stiff. About 30 percent of the time when I pull the door closed, it doesn't pull tight. No problem on the passenger side. I will be taking it in to my dealer, but just wondered if anyone else had a similar problem?
The doors are solid on all the Mini's I've been in, very unlike pretty much every American car I've ever owned. If you don't give the doors a good pull they'll sometimes only latch part way. This seems especially true the newer the car is. My Coupe is/was the same but I chalked that up to being used to shutting the tinny lightweight doors of my Jeep Liberty for so long. The doors themselves don't seem to be out of alignment.
Yes to the driver's door not always fully latching and agreed with the comment that MINI doors are heavy and not always as willing to stay open when I need them open. For such a small car, the doors seem big in both thickness and in length. Seems like I have to swing the door fairly wide to get out.
First time mine didn't latch all the way I thought the seatbelt had gotten caught in the door. I've noticed the partial latching while closing from both the inside and outside.
